Hotel Italiaken's history begins in 1874, when an Italian man named Pietro Miliore opened the first Western-style restaurant in Japan. It continued developing into "Niigata's Rokumeikan," a fathering place for people from the worlds of finance and culture. Now, after 100 years, it has been reborn as a hotel that retains the character of the past but also boasts modern facilities and serves as a place for local and international cultural communication.
